A two bedroom top floor apartment with A 14ft living/dining room, allocated parking, stunning views over weston shore and the solent & is being offered with no forward chain! This fantastic apartment offers a spacious open plan Living/Dining Room with a Juliet balcony that offers fantastic views over Weston Shore and The Solent. There is a Kitchen Area with a wide range of storage cupboards. There are two bedrooms both with water views. Plus a family bathroom. In the Hallway is access to the loft storage area, ideal for additional storage. This fantastic property is being offered to the market with no forward chain and also benefits from allocated off road parking & visitors parking.
Located across the road from Weston Shore, where you can see some of the world’s largest cruise ships coming into dock or setting sail. Woolston shopping precinct is 0.8 miles away offering a wide range of shops and amenities. The recently built Centenary Quay offers a range of bars, restaurants and leisure facilities. Southampton City centre is less than two miles away. Or why not walk along Weston Shore to the historic village of Netley Abbey where you can enjoy the medieval ruins of the Abbey or 220 acres of the Royal Victoria Country Park. There are several sailing clubs nearby and so is a 9 hole pitch and putt with its own a cafe.
